Farrah (Orange County)
Florida LAKEWATCH Water Chemistry Summary
Location: Latitude 28°30'30", Longitude 81°19'16"
Period of record: 60 sampling dates; February 4, 1991 to December 10, 1999
Surface area (Shafer et al. 1986): 8 acres / 3 hectacres
Lake Region (Griffith et al. 1997): Orlando Ridge
Geologic formation (Brooks 1981):
The geology is dominated by phosphatic sand, silty sand, and clay of the Hawthorne Formation.
Physiographic region (Brooks 1981):
The water body lies in the Orlando Promontory division of the Central Lake District.
